- WHO WE ARE:
- As was mentioned, we are Music Unlimited, a unique music
- management company founded in 1991 by David Graham, son of the
- late rock impresario Bill Graham. In addition to being a young
- company with lots of energy and enthusiasm, we've got the contacts
- and experience of the country's most successful and prestigious
- promoter, Bill Graham Presents. Since our inception, we have
- been involved with a number of fascinating and diverse projects
- such as: the first ever 100% environmentally sound concert with The
- Band, Ziggy Marley, and many others; the special arts/education/
- awareness fair for Lollapalooza '92 (in conjunction with BGP); and
- the 1992 H.O.R.D.E. tour with Blues Traveler, Phish, The Spin
- Doctors, Bela Fleck and The Flecktones, Widespread Panic,
- and Colonel Bruce Hampton and The Aquarium Rescue Unit.
-
- In addition to all of these achievements, most of Music Unlimited's
- energy has been dedicated to discovering and breaking the most
- exciting new talent in the country. The first band we worked with
- was Blues Traveler, in fact, it was largely through a network of
- college students that David, while finishing his senior year at college,
- was able to help break the band nationally. Now that Blues Traveler
- is established as one of the leading bands of the Nineties, Music
- Unlimited has taken on two hot new acts from New York, The
- Authority and The Mad Hatters. We are now in the process of
- letting the rest of the country how great these bands are.
